Below are the video contents:
Mathematical Formulas such as SUM, AVERAGE, RAND, MIN & MAX, SUMPRODUCT.
Textual Formulas such as TRIM, CONCATENATE, SUBSTITUTE, UPPER & LOWER, LENGTH, LEFT, RIGHT & MID
Logical Formulas such as AND & OR, IF, COUNTIF, SUMIF
Date-time (Temporal) Formulas such as TODAY & NOW, DAY, MONTH & YEAR, DATEDIF & DAYS
Lookup Formulas such as VLOOKUP, HLOOKUP, INDEX, MATCH
